[Bug 1507241] [NEW] Bad regexps in *_these_nonmembers, subscribe_auto_approval and ban_list should be logged

The list attributes *_these_nonmembers, subscribe_auto_approval and
ban_list accept lists of email addresses and regexps (beginning with
'^') matching email addresses. Currently, if the regexp is invalid, it
is silently ignored. The GUI does not accept invalid regexp entries, but
there are other ways they could be introduced. An invalid regexp should
at least be logged.
